What is the primary goal of the Common Application personal statement from an admissions committee's perspective?

A To demonstrate impeccable grammar and vocabulary.
B To reveal the applicant's unique personality, voice, and potential fit.
C To list additional accomplishments not mentioned elsewhere in the application.
D To summarize the applicant's academic transcript.

✓ Correct Answer: Option B

The personal statement's main purpose is to showcase an applicant's character, perspective, and voice, offering insights beyond academic records and activity lists, helping committees assess fit.
